Leanne Morgan’s Southern Charm Hits Netflix

Last updated: July 31, 2025 1:50 am
Share
Leanne Morgan’s Southern Charm Hits Netflix
SHARE

Leanne Morgan, the beloved comedian, saw a significant shift in her life when she hit her mid-50s. This transformation also reflects in the character she portrays on the Netflix series “Leanne,” albeit in a less dramatic manner. After years of juggling stand-up comedy with raising three kids in East Tennessee, Morgan experienced a surge in popularity on social media during the pandemic. Her porch videos resonated with a vast audience of older moms, propelling her into the upper echelons of the comedy world.

The fictional character, Leanne, faces a similar upheaval when her on-screen husband, Bill, played by Ryan Stiles, abruptly leaves her for a younger woman. This storyline prompts her to reevaluate her relationships, mirroring real-life experiences. Despite the parallels between the two Leannes, the show remains relatable and charming due to its folksy humor and well-crafted ensemble cast.

To bring her comedic talents to the small screen, Morgan collaborates with Chuck Lorre, a veteran in the multi-camera sitcom genre, and showrunner Susan McMartin. While Morgan initially favored a single-camera setup inspired by “Parks and Recreation,” the traditional Lorre style aligns better with her comedic sensibilities. The decision to structure the show around a stand-up comedian harks back to the golden era of sitcoms like “Roseanne” and “Seinfeld,” adding a nostalgic touch to the storytelling.

“Leanne” resonates with Morgan’s existing fan base through its humor about aging, family dynamics, and Southern culture. The show seamlessly weaves in elements from Morgan’s stand-up routines, creating an authentic and endearing portrayal of her life. The character of Leanne exudes warmth and familiarity, reminiscent of a grandmother sharing anecdotes at a family gathering.

The series surrounds Leanne with a supporting cast that complements her character’s journey. Her sister, Carol, played by Kristen Johnston, provides a relatable confidante, while other family members add depth to the familial dynamic. As the narrative unfolds, viewers witness the complexities of relationships and the resilience of the human spirit amidst life’s challenges.

Netflix’s decision to release an extended 16-episode season of “Leanne” sets it apart from typical streaming offerings. While the initial episodes hint at potential storylines and character development, the full season promises a more immersive viewing experience. The show’s breezy runtime and engaging narrative make it a binge-worthy delight for audiences seeking lighthearted entertainment.

Overall, “Leanne” caters to a wide audience with its blend of humor, heartwarming moments, and relatable characters. While some aspects of the show’s portrayal of body image and appearance may be contentious, the genuine affection for Leanne shines through. As viewers delve into Leanne’s world, they are treated to a mix of laughter, nostalgia, and heartfelt storytelling.

All episodes of “Leanne” Season 1 are now available for streaming on Netflix, inviting viewers to embark on a heartfelt and comedic journey with the endearing Leanne.
